MIAMI (Feb. 19, 2023) – Baseball closed out the opening series of 2023 with George Mason on Sunday losing the game, 5-2.
Redshirt senior
Alec Sanchez extended his hit streak to three games going 2-4, while junior
Ryne Guida earned his second RBI in as many games.
The Panthers opened the scoring in the first to take a 1-0 lead. Guida hit a double to deep left center to drive in junior
Dante Girardi.
George Mason responded in the next half inning with a solo home run to tie the score at 1-1.
The Patriots took the lead for the first time after driving in three runs in the top of the fifth, bringing the score to 4-1.
FIU put together a strong bottom of the fifth, drawing two walks and hitting a single to load the bases. A well hit ball up the middle by Girardi would turn into a double play but drive in a run, making the score 4-2.
The Panthers would earn four more hits but could not mount a comeback, eventually dropping the series deciding game, 5-2.
